## LiftSim Environments

Quick refresher for the sync: LiftSim (our elevator-dispatch simulator) runs in three environments — sandbox, staging, and prod-shadow. Sandbox resets nightly, staging mirrors the Kestrel Tower dataset, and prod-shadow replays real dispatch traffic. Only staging needs manual tuning. Here are the staging configuration values we currently run with:

service settings:
[briius]
port = 3000
region = outer-1
host = briius.zarqeldyn.internal
team = wenael
timeout_ms = 2000
retries = 5

Renamed CHECKOUT_LOADGEN_MODE to SURGE_PROFILE across the Pellwick load-testing harness, since it now covers the whole checkout flow, not just cart adds. Old name still works with a deprecation warning until next release. Heads up for reviewers: the harness hits the staging payment stub, which now requires auth after the Darnow incident. Each runner reads its env file at startup, so the stub credential has to live there. Add that credential line to the runner's env file now.

secret setting of hawep-yahig: LEDGER_TOKEN29=41b5d6315371c92885eaeb077fb63

Handover — Ferranti Logistics contract renewal. Current terms expire end of Q3; volume rebates are the main open item. Finance should hold the draft at the proposed 2% uplift, no index clause. Counterparty has signalled flexibility on payment terms. Decision authority sits with the new director. Background on why we're holding firm is noted below.

confidential, bahof-yaweg: Headcount on the Kaseth team goes from 32 to 109 by the end of January. Gross margin on Kaseth came in at 46 percent against a plan of 45 percent.

Subject: Wiki RBAC cut-over done. Cut-over to role-based access on Ledgerleaf wiki finished at 02:10. Legacy ACLs are read-only until Thursday, then deleted. If pages go dark, check the role-mapping job first — it reruns hourly. Escalate only if the mapper fails twice in a row. The new permission service is running with the values listed below.

settings of tagef-bawif:
DRUIX_HOST=druix.zemvarlabs.internal
DRUIX_PORT=8000